Sonic (a classic version of himself technically(?!)) does the spin dash attack to gotta go fast to move fast whenever he wants pretty much, unlike S&K3 we can compare the charged up version and non charged up version instead of just a baseline spin dash; we can compare his movement speed here on screen directly to the velocity of the Eggrobo's lasers they shoot at him, which act as natural light would be expected to; lasers travel at the speed of light by name description of being light.

Non-charged spin dash:

50 - 36 = 14
Laser beam moves 14 pixels in 1 frame
381 - 302 = 79
Sonic moves 79 pixels in 1 frame
The speed of light is 299,792,458 meters / second
Sonic's movement speed with the spin dash = 299,792,458 * (79/14) = 1,691,686,013 m/s or 5.64285714286 times faster than the speed of light
Charged up spin dash:

174 - 65 = 109
Using the same images as prior, the light beam moves 14 pixels in 1 frame
Sonic's movement speed with the spin dash = 299,792,458 * (109/14) = 2,334,098,423 m/s or 7.78571428571 times faster than the speed of light
